National Seed Corporation- Assistance for boosting seed production in private sector
Govt. of India realizing the need for increased seed production in the high volume low
value crops has proposed to provide assistance for boosting seed production in the private
sector. The scheme is implemented through National Seeds Corporation under the administrative
control of Department of Agriculture Cooperation & Farmer’s Welfare, Ministry of
Agriculture and Farmers Welfare..
Pattern of Assistance
The scheme provides assistance in the following form.
- Credit linked back ended Capital Subsidy
- 40% of project cost for General Areas with maximum cap of Rs. 60 Lakhs
- 50% of project cost for Scheduled Areas with maximum cap of Rs. 75 Lakhs
Eligible components of the Scheme
The scheme supports the following components
- Seed Godown
- Seed Pre-cleaner
- Seed Cleaner-cum-Grader
- Indent Cylinder
- Conveyor System
- Seed Elevator
- Seed Treater
- Seed Drying Unit.
- Seed Holding Bins.
- Weighing Machine.
- Bag Closer
- DG Set
- Transportation, freight, erection, commissioning and electrification charges
- Other connected equipments/accessories/different sieve sizes
- Seed Testing Laboratory Equipments.
Cost Capping for release of Subsidy
- ✅ Godown with AC / GI sheet – Rs. 7000 per sq. mt.
- ✅ Storage godown with flat roof – Rs. 7500 per sq. mt.
- ✅ Seed processing plant structure – Rs. 7000 per sq. mt.
Important to Remember
The detailed project report has to be as per the norms of the scheme
- Term loan is mandatory
- Subsidy is released into the SRF account of the bank
- The project should be complete within 15 months from disbursement of Term Loan
